Technical Specifications

Parameters and characteristics for this part

SpecificationADC0804LCWM
ArchitectureSAR
ConfigurationADC
Data InterfaceParallel
Input TypeDifferential
Mounting TypeSurface Mount
Number of A/D Converters1
Number of Bits8
Number of Inputs1
Operating Temperature [Max]85 °C
Operating Temperature [Min]-40 °C
Package / Case20-SOIC
Package / Case [y]0.295 in
Package / Case [y]7.5 mm
Reference TypeSupply, External
Sampling Rate (Per Second)10 k per second
Supplier Device Package20-SOIC
Voltage - Supply, Analog [Max]6.3 V
Voltage - Supply, Analog [Min]4.5 V
Voltage - Supply, Digital [Max]6.3 V
Voltage - Supply, Digital [Min]4.5 V

General part information

ADC0804-N Series

The ADC0801, ADC0802, ADC0803, ADC0804, and ADC0805 devices are CMOS 8-bit successive approximation converters (ADC) that use a differential potentiometric ladder – similar to the 256R products. These converters are designed to allow operation with the NSC800 and INS8080A derivative control bus with Tri-state output latches directly driving the data bus. These ADCs appear like memory locations or I/O ports to the microprocessor and no interfacing logic is needed.

Differential analog voltage inputs allow increasing the common-mode rejection and offsetting the analog zero input voltage value. In addition, the voltage reference input can be adjusted to allow encoding any smaller analog voltage span to the full 8 bits of resolution.
